Output ab8e2a8e5e0f60a3fd9fab206e57059fa3a2a2df6dc3e5e33596cceeffdbdd76:1

value
99787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95ea92934ccb1bfdf12988e9b561ea56cfe5f852 OP_EQUAL
address
3FMhcWkKPjNXZUQdCdC8RpdgEGrkCraSnh
transaction
ab8e2a8e5e0f60a3fd9fab206e57059fa3a2a2df6dc3e5e33596cceeffdbdd76
confirmations
389289
spent
true